Chapter 2: Enter the Servo Motor Hydraulic Pump—Precision on Demand

So what exactly is a servo motor hydraulic pump?

In simple terms, it’s a combination of a servo motor—an intelligent, closed-loop-controlled electric motor—and a hydraulic pump, often a variable displacement or internal gear pump.

When you pair them, you get an energy-efficient powerhouse that only draws power when needed. Unlike traditional systems that run constantly, this setup:

  • Responds to demand instantly

  • Maintains consistent pressure without waste

  • Offers extreme precision even under fluctuating loads

Chapter 3: The Brain Behind the Brawn—Load Sensing Proportional Valves

You can’t just upgrade one component and expect a revolution. The servo motor hydraulic pump is powerful, but its true magic shines when paired with load sensing proportional valves.

These valves sense load pressure changes and adjust flow accordingly. Here's what that means for you:

  • Better energy efficiency—you’re not wasting power on unnecessary flow

  • Improved machine safety—load changes won’t lead to shocks or spikes

  • Smarter control—more responsive to user input and environmental factors

Chapter 4: Your Eyes in the Cylinder—The Role of Linear Position Sensors

All this precision is meaningless if you don’t know exactly where your actuator is at any moment.

That’s why you should consider integrating a linear position sensor for hydraulic cylinder.

These sensors give real-time feedback on cylinder position, allowing your servo system to:

  • Stop instantly at any point within the stroke

  • Maintain repeatable motion—ideal for automation

  • Adjust on-the-fly to external forces or wear-and-tear

Chapter 7: Choosing the Right Components—What to Look For

As you explore this route, you’ll want to choose wisely. Here’s what you should evaluate:

Servo Motor Price vs. Performance

Don’t just go by sticker price. Look at lifecycle cost, energy savings, and control accuracy.

Compatibility with Load Sensing Systems

Make sure your servo motor pump setup works hand-in-hand with load sensing proportional valves, or better yet, has integrated sensing logic.

Sensor Feedback Integration

Pick linear position sensors that support real-time communication protocols like CANopen or IO-Link. This ensures seamless integration.

Availability of Components

Look for suppliers who offer not just the pump and motor, but hydraulic motors for sale, brake system valves, and power packs so your ecosystem is consistent and serviceable.

Chapter 9: Installation, Calibration, and Smart Startups

You might worry that a high-tech system means high-complexity installation. But that’s not the case.

Many modern servo motor hydraulic pumps come with pre-configured drive software, easy-to-pair sensors, and plug-and-play power packs. Here's what you should prepare for:

  1. Mount the motor and pump on a stable platform

  2. Connect the sensors to your cylinder

  3. Wire the drive to your PLC or controller

  4. Calibrate with software, often in a few steps

  5. Run dry tests before activating under load
